Environmental Considerations:
When designing systems incorporating XC7S75-2FGGA484I, several environmental factors must be taken into account to ensure optimal performance and reliability.
1. Temperature: XC7S75-2FGGA484I is designed to operate within a specific temperature range. High temperatures can affect its performance and longevity, while low temperatures may lead to functionality issues or even failure. Thermal management techniques, such as heat sinks, fans, or thermal interface materials, are employed to regulate the FPGA's temperature and prevent overheating or cold-related malfunctions.
2. Humidity: Excessive humidity can cause moisture ingress, leading to corrosion and electrical short circuits. Conformal coating or encapsulation techniques are often used to protect XC7S75-2FGGA484I from moisture and ensure long-term reliability, especially in humid environments.
3. Altitude: At high altitudes, the reduced air pressure can affect the FPGA's cooling efficiency and alter its operating characteristics. Proper ventilation and thermal design are crucial to maintain XC7S75-2FGGA484I within its specified temperature range at varying altitudes.
